RE: JJ ECC 803S tubes, any good?

thanks, SET, I was looking to use them as a general purpose 12AX7 tube at a decent price in various vintage amps, like Fisher, Scott, etc. The ones I see now on the AES site are totally different from the ones I got years ago, the new ones have the 12AX7 look and I believe I heard that they are much superior to the older frame grid looking ones. While I do have a selection of tele's, mullards, RCA & Sylvania, and amperexes, I don't have enough to go around so an inexpensive modern is something I would like to consider as well as try out for sound comparisons to my vintage used noted above.
